What the Best Places to Buy an EV Recognition Means
The Best Places to Buy an EV recognition is awarded to dealerships based on a variety of factors, including:
- Strong knowledge of electric vehicles and charging
- Consistent availability of EV inventory
- Survey responses from over 30,000 EV owners

Exclusive Interview with Lee Johnson Kia & Recurrent
In a recent interview on EV Insider, Pete Berkey, General Manager of Lee Johnson Kia, spoke with Recurrent’s Scott Case about the evolving EV landscape, what influences buyer behavior in Kirkland, and where he sees the market heading.
One of the most defining characteristics of the local EV market?
“[Our customers] like technology. Technology drives them and they like driving technology.”
With major tech employers like Microsoft, Google, and Meta located just minutes away, Lee Johnson Kia serves a highly educated, tech-forward customer base. Many buyers are deeply familiar with the innovation behind EVs, making advanced features and performance a top priority.
Berkey also noted that EVs are no longer niche in Kirkland:
- EVs account for 30–40% of total vehicle sales at the dealership
- Demand remains strong despite changes to federal incentives
- Shoppers are highly engaged with both vehicle tech and charging ecosystems

Looking Ahead: EV Growth and What’s Next
While some automakers are increasing focus on hybrids and plug-in hybrids, EV demand in the Seattle-area market remains strong.
Lee Johnson Kia expects continued momentum, supported by:
- High EV adoption rates locally
- A well-developed charging infrastructure
- Ongoing innovation from Kia’s EV lineup
One model generating significant excitement is the upcoming Kia EV3.
Berkey believes it could be a game-changer:
- Expected price point in the mid-$30K range
- Estimated range of 320 miles
- Designed to make EV ownership accessible to a broader audience
This model could help bridge the gap for buyers who want an affordable EV without sacrificing range or features.

Are there any federal tax credits or rebates available for EVs in 2026?
The federal clean vehicle tax credit is no longer available for vehicles acquired after September 30, 2025. Other local incentives may still apply. Please contact us for details.
